What's Happening?
The new series 'Alien: Earth' delves into a transhumanist future where human consciousness is transferred to synthetic bodies. The show, created by Noah Hawley, presents a world dominated by corporations and explores the ethical and scientific implications of consciousness transfer. Experts weigh in on the feasibility of such technology, highlighting the challenges in understanding and replicating human consciousness.
Why It's Important?
The concept of transferring human consciousness to synthetic bodies raises significant ethical and scientific questions. It challenges our understanding of identity, consciousness, and the potential for technological advancements to alter human existence. The series prompts discussions on the implications of such technology for society, including issues of equity, consent, and the definition of self.
Beyond the Headlines
The exploration of consciousness transfer in 'Alien: Earth' reflects broader societal concerns about the role of technology in shaping human identity and the potential for a 'digital immortality divide.' The series highlights the need for ethical considerations and regulations in the development of advanced technologies that could fundamentally alter human life.
